About NamSys Inc.
NamSys Inc. provides software solutions for currency management and processing for the banking and merchant industries in North America. It offers Cirreon Smart Safe, an open cloud-based digital platform for managing networks of smart safes; Cash in Transit Logistics that manages routes, scans barcodes, and captures signatures digitally; and Cash Vault Management for use in credit reconciliation, cash inventory optimization, and store-to-vault customer integration. The company also provides Deposit Tracking for tracking digital deposit data and transmits real-time updates; and Online Change Orders for submitting online change orders and digital change order data tracking. It serves financial institutions, cash-in-transit industry, and smart safe industry. The company was formerly known as Cencotech Inc. and changed its name to NamSys Inc. in November 2016. NamSys Inc. was founded in 1989 and is based in Toronto, Canada.
NamSys Inc. (CTZ.V) stock trades at $1.17 with a market capitalization of $31.42M. The stock is valued at a price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of 13.00, price-to-book of 3.97, price-to-sales of 3.83. Over the past 52 weeks the stock has ranged between $0.97 and $1.65, and currently trades 29.1% below its 52-week high.
On profitability, NamSys Inc. generates a return on equity (ROE) of 29.08% — well above the market average, a sign of a high-quality business, an operating margin of 39.29%, a net profit margin of 30.93%.
